Premier League: Hooked on Brighton (1-1), Chelsea chained a fourth match without success in the league

Chelsea is really not there anymore. While the Blues had to put their heads back in place after the loss with heavy consequences against Manchester City, Thomas Tuchel’s men followed up with a sad draw on the lawn of Brighton (1-1). The worst ? The Londoners are doing very, very well with regard to the face of the match, where they have never shown control to respond to the good performance of the Seagulls. There is real danger in the remains for Chelsa, who have won only one game in the last seven days of the Premier League. If the reigning European champion does not extricate himself from this quagmire, we will have to start looking in the rear view mirror.

You only have to zoom in on Hakim Ziyech to realize how much evil seems to be deep in the ranks of Chelsea, who once again showed a poor face, as too often in recent weeks. Nervous, like his teammates, the Moroccan did not even bother to celebrate his goal, the only illumination for the Blues in this endless evening, preferring to rail against his partners at the slightest bad choice. Against the run of play, he placed a sudden strike that surprised everyone (0-1, 28th), while Tuchel’s players hadn’t shown anything very positive since kick-off.

The poor face of Chelsea

For its part, Brighton took advantage of the opponent’s lack of confidence, materialized by a lot of waste, to take the game on its own without ever really letting go. First there was awkwardness for the Seagulls, who had the merit of not diving after having cruelly conceded the opener. Because the Blues did not know how to capitalize on Ziyech’s goal to make it a springboard, continuing to be too feverish to obtain a good result. The equalizer was also symbolic: while Kepa Arrizabalaga had just achieved a small feat, Adam Webster punished defensive passivity on receiving a corner (1-1, 60th).

It took until the last ten minutes to see a semblance of a reaction of pride from Chelsea, under the impetus of a triple change made by Thomas Tuchel. Alas, despite a resounding start, Timo Werner did not have time to turn the tide to avoid a fourth game in a row without a win for Chelsea in the league. A few weeks ago, the Londoners were still fighting for the title. Today, it is their place on the podium that is threatened and Tuchel will have to quickly find solutions so that the initially ideal idyll does not quickly turn into a story without a future.
